Динамическое изменение названия приложения в UWP - PullRequest
0 голосов
/ 06 июля 2018

В настоящее время я создаю приложение, которое в какой-то момент начинает запись экрана с помощью игрового видеорегистратора Windows. Этот рекордер принимает имя приложения в качестве имени файла после завершения записи.
Я узнал, как изменить заголовок приложения, используя Applicationview.GetForCurrentView (); и это меняет заголовок окна моего приложения. Однако, это не берет этот заголовок в имя файла после записи.
Когда я записываю что-то вроде документа Word или моего проекта Visual Studio, оно показывает конкретное имя в имени файла, поэтому должен быть другой уровень, на котором необходимо изменить имя.
У кого-нибудь есть идея?

1 Ответ

0 голосов
/ 06 июля 2018

Основываясь на этой теме , вы не можете этого сделать.

Кажется, что Xbox DVR получает имя установленного приложения, которое нельзя изменить во время выполнения.Для изменения названия приложения вам необходимо сначала удалить приложение, изменить Package.appxmanifest, а затем установить приложение.

Как насчет небольшого обходного пути здесь.Вы знаете имя своего приложения, когда оно установлено, и знаете, где Xbox DVR сохраняет записи видеофайлов.Вы можете написать наблюдателя файловой системы, который будет распознавать новые файлы в этом каталоге и переименовывать их в соответствии с вашими потребностями.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...